Exploring Galway's History at St. Nicholas Collegiate Church

23 August, 11:30am - 3:30pm

  • St Nicholas Collegiate Church
  • Lombard Street
  • H91 PY20
  • Co. Galway – City

Join us for a fun and educational day in St. Nicholas Collegiate Church Galway on Saturday 23rd August from 11:30 to 15:30!
Have a go at Medieval Sword Play with the help of Cluain Óir, Society for Creative Re-enactment, Galway Branch.
Try your hand at Calligraphy, Medieval Dance, Lucet Weaving and have a taste of Medieval snacks.
Try on some Medieval Clothes and take your picture.
Learn a Cúpla Focal with help from Gailimh le Geilge and try your hand at Celtic patterns.
Learn about ancient Irish weaving techniques.
Children of all ages can colour in Celtic patterns and design their own Coat of Arms.
Treasure trails suitable for children ages 4 years to 6 years and 7 years to 10 years.
Take a guided tour with Lady Catherine and let the stones tell the story of St. Nicholas Church.
Enjoy some free refreshments while you listen to medieval music.
